Past Presidents Advisory Council

The Past Presidents Advisory Council (PPAC) is a newly formed (2019) rotating advisory group comprised of the five most recent past presidents. They serve as a source of chapter history and continuity for larger chapter initiatives. The group will support the chapter by taking on initiatives assigned by the President that affect beyond the immediate year or immediate chapter (i.e., revising chapter bylaws or assisting in coordination with ISPE International for the annual meeting in Philadelphia). The PPAC is chaired by the immediate past president and is the point of contact between the board and PPAC. The members of the advisory council change annually as the board changes.
